House of Heavilin Beauty College-Kansas City vs. Missouri College of Cosmetology and Esthetics
Both House of Heavilin Beauty College-Kansas City and Missouri College of Cosmetology and Esthetics are Private, Less than 2 years schools located in Missouri. The following statements compare House of Heavilin Beauty College-Kansas City and Missouri College of Cosmetology and Esthetics with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- House of Heavilin Beauty College-Kansas City's tuition ($22,100) is more expensive than Missouri College of Cosmetology and Esthetics ($17,925).
- Missouri College of Cosmetology and Esthetics's students to faculty ratio (19 to 1) is lower than House of Heavilin Beauty College-Kansas City (25 to 1).
- Missouri College of Cosmetology and Esthetics (97 students) is larger than House of Heavilin Beauty College-Kansas City (55 students) with more enrolled students.
- House of Heavilin Beauty College-Kansas City ($6,164) has higher amount of financial aid than Missouri College of Cosmetology and Esthetics ($4,171).
- Missouri College of Cosmetology and Esthetics's graduation rate (79%) is higher than House of Heavilin Beauty College-Kansas City (44%).
